THE TOWN OF AKRANES
〜 An old charming Town on the west coast of Iceland
Facing urban renewal with industrial renovation In the outskirts of a metropolitan area
The potential growth of Akranes will depend on increased role of sustainable and creative activities in modern economy.
Built around fishing and industry
Main Emphasis Is on a beautiful and family-friendly town with a healthy environment, a powerful and diverse economy and a solid transportation
• Tunnel under the fjord revolution in transportation
• Significant changes in the labour market
• An old cement factory covers a large industrial area in the heart of the town
• 7000 inhabitants
• Lacking diversity in the business sector
• Looking towards reconstructions in the food industry and tourism
• Better supply of cheaper housing than in the capital
• Industrial area can serve as an important role in urban renewal
